The street in brief

Cherry Tree Gardens is almost entirely detached houses. Homes here typically change hands around £215,000 — roughly 16% above the BD10 norm. On floor area that works out near £2,328 per square metre, in line with the district's £2,342. Too few recent sales to read a street-level trend, but across BD10 prices have been rising over the last few years. With 6 sales across 5 homes since 2001, homes here come to market only rarely.

Cherry Tree Gardens's £215,000 median sits about 16% above BD10's £185,000; on floor space it runs £2,328/m² against the district's £2,342/m².

Street and BD10 figures are medians of HM Land Registry sales; the England figures are the UK House Price Index mix-adjusted average — a different basis, so compare direction rather than levels between the two.
